Frequently Asked Questions

Everything you need to know about React Analytics, from self-hosting to supported platforms and data privacy.

  • Is React Analytics really free?

    Yes! The free tier includes 1 project and 10,000 events per month. Perfect for side projects and small applications.Plus, being open source, you can self-host it completely free on your own infrastructure.

  • Can I self-host React Analytics?

    Absolutely! React Analytics is fully open source and self-hostable. You get complete control over your data and infrastructure.We provide comprehensive documentation and Docker support to make self-hosting easy. Check our GitHub repository for the full self-hosting guide.

  • What platforms are supported?

    Our analytics library works seamlessly with React, React Native, Expo, and Next.js. One package, universal compatibility.It automatically detects your router (Next.js App Router, Expo Router, React Router) and tracks navigation events without any configuration.

  • How is my data stored?

    For our hosted solution, we use PostgreSQL with industry-standard security practices. Your data is encrypted at rest and in transit.For self-hosted deployments, you have complete control—use PostgreSQL, MySQL, or SQLite on your own infrastructure.
